Education Cabinet Secretary Julius Ogamba has dismissed claims the government has reduced capitation to schools, cautioning against politicisation of education. Speaking at a public engagement, Ogamba says the Ministry of Education has not proposed or implemented any reduction in capitation, calling for a sober public discourse on the matter to avoid causing panic.
